Description
The ultimate app for the executives on the move is here. Now you can now track the details of your projects hosted on Azure DevOps right from your mobile phone and stay informed.The app uses the API’s provided by Microsoft Azure DevOps to display the status of the projects.
Features of the App:
• Beautiful dashboard with key metrics represented graphically
• Switch and work with multiple DevOps Organization, projects, teams and iterations seamlessly
• View build status for the various build definitions in the project
• View the changesets created by your team
• View the team member assignments and current status of the various work items in the project
• Drill-down into the work items to view the status
• View the details of the work items
Audience:
• Team Leads and Team Managers
• Account Managers
• Stakeholders

Q: What is an APK File?
A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.
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?
A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
